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Hibernate Java Discussion :

Jointure tables quelques explications


Sujet :

Hibernate Java

  1. #1
    Membre régulier
    Inscrit en
    mars 2006
    Messages
    227
    Détails du profil
    Informations forums :
    Inscription : mars 2006
    Messages : 227
    Points : 109
    Points
    109
    Par défaut Jointure tables quelques explications
    j'ai 3 tables

    tables:
    ------
    utilisateur : uti_id, nom ...
    client : cli_id, nom ...
    client_utilisateur : uti_id,cli_id.

    fichier client.hbm.xml
    ---------------------
    je passe les déclarations des propriétés voici la déclaration de la jointure
    des 2 tables.

    <join table="client_utilisateur" inverse="true" optional="true">
    <key column="cli_id"/>
    <many-to-one name="utilisateurid" column="utilisateurid" not-null="true"/>
    </join>

    je reçois le message suivant : que la proprité utilisateurid n'existe pas, dois-je définir une bean qui represente ma table client_utilisateur? avec comme propriété les id des 2 tables? je ne comprend très comment déclarer une jointure entre deux tables.

  2. #2
    Expert confirmé
    Profil pro
    Inscrit en
    août 2006
    Messages
    3 261
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: août 2006
    Messages : 3 261
    Points : 4 099
    Points
    4 099
    Par défaut
    Si tu veux représenter une simple relation n <-> n et que ta table client_utilisateur ne contient pas d'infos autres que les clefs de client et utilisateur, un simple many-to-many suffit.

  3. #3
    Membre régulier
    Inscrit en
    mars 2006
    Messages
    227
    Détails du profil
    Informations forums :
    Inscription : mars 2006
    Messages : 227
    Points : 109
    Points
    109
    Par défaut
    je vais essayer et je te dis quoi merci pour l'info

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Jointure tables inexistantes
    Par ballmaster dans le forum 4D
    Réponses: 1
    Dernier message: 18/06/2007, 17h38
  2. Quelques explications pour utilisation finale
    Par Cooly dans le forum Maven
    Réponses: 3
    Dernier message: 13/03/2007, 12h07
  3. Jointures Tables Sap
    Par Pierren dans le forum SAP
    Réponses: 6
    Dernier message: 19/01/2007, 10h09
  4. visualiser jointures tables
    Par lolothom dans le forum Requêtes
    Réponses: 3
    Dernier message: 05/09/2006, 16h06
  5. mod_rewrite : quelques explications
    Par webrider dans le forum Apache
    Réponses: 4
    Dernier message: 20/08/2006, 09h36

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o